#if defined(LIBC_SCCS) && !defined(lint)
/*static char *sccsid = "from: @(#)fopen.c	5.5 (Berkeley) 2/5/91";*/
static char *rcsid = "$Id$";
#endif /* LIBC_SCCS and not lint */

#include <pthread.h>
#include <sys/types.h>
#include <sys/stat.h>
#include <fcntl.h>
#include <stdio.h>
#include <errno.h>
#include "local.h"

extern pthread_mutex_t __sfp_mutex;
extern pthread_cond_t __sfp_cond;
extern int __sfp_state;

FILE *fopen(const char *file, const char *mode)
{
	register FILE *fp;
	register int f;
	int flags, oflags;

	if ((flags = __sflags(mode, &oflags)) == 0)
		return (NULL);
	if ((f = open(file, oflags, 0666)) < 0) {
		return (NULL);
	}

	__sinit ();
    pthread_mutex_lock(&__sfp_mutex);
    while (__sfp_state) {
        pthread_cond_wait(&__sfp_cond, &__sfp_mutex);
    }

	if (fp = __sfp()) {
		fp->_file = f;
		fp->_flags = flags;
	
		/*
		 * When opening in append mode, even though we use O_APPEND,
		 * we need to seek to the end so that ftell() gets the right
		 * answer.  If the user then alters the seek pointer, or
		 * the file extends, this will fail, but there is not much
		 * we can do about this.  (We could set __SAPP and check in
		 * fseek and ftell.)
		 */
		if (oflags & O_APPEND)
			(void) __sseek((void *)fp, (off_t)0, SEEK_END);
	}
	pthread_mutex_unlock(&__sfp_mutex);
	return (fp);
}
